Largest Peninsula in Virginia

The Eastern Shore is a peninsula bordered by the Chesapeake Bay to the west and the Atlantic Ocean to the east. It is part of the Costal Plain/Tidewater Region.

Major Rivers of Virginia

Each river was a source of food and provided a pathway for exploration and the settlement of Virginia. Many early Virginia cities developed along the Fall Line, the natural border between the Costal Plain/Tidewater and Piedmont regions where the land rises sharply and where rockes and waterfalls prevent further travel on the river.
